HOUSTON – Firefighters are at the scene of a fire at an apartment complex on the northwest side of Houston Tuesday evening. The fire is located at 2703 Teague Road. Video shot from Beltway 8 by KPRC 2’s Bryce Newberry shows a plume of smoke off in the distance from the fire.

HOUSTON, Texas (KTRK) -- Crews are working to put out a fire at an apartment complex in southeast Houston on Tuesday. Houston Fire Department firefighters could be seen battling the flames off the Gulf Freeway in the afternoon. SkyEye also flew over the complex, which suffered significant damage due to the flames.
